Background: This study evaluates the predictive significance of salivary amylase, glutathione, lipid peroxides, and lactate dehydrogenase in the treatment of head and neck cancer patients who undergo curative radiotherapy/chemoradiotherapy.Methods: The volunteers for the study included head and neck cancer patients that required curative radiotherapy/chemoradiotherapy. Patients provided saliva and blood samples before the start of radiation treatment and ۲۴ h after the first radiation fraction of ۲ Gy (before the start of the second fraction). Samples were assessed for the levels of blood and salivary amylase, glutathione, lipid peroxides, and lactate dehydrogenase by standard laboratory methods.
